Brighton: Miniclick & Friends Summer Party. 14th July, ’18

July 12, 2018 by Jim Stephenson

This weekend, Miniclick are teaming up with Fishing Quarter Gallery, Spectrum, Social Daze and Ali Tollervey (who we co-curated Behind the Beat with) to host a Summer Social on Brighton’s seafront. We start at Fishing Quarter Gallery for the private view of their new Summer Exhibition from 6pm, then we will make the short walk to Fortune of War for a Social and a relaxed sunset session from Richie Phoe followed by sets from The Freakaholic DJs, Ali Tollervey, Steve […]

Leeds: Girls Girls Girls! with Casey Orr and Nudrat Afza, 18th April ’18

March 28, 2018 by Jim Stephenson

After the beast from the east cancelled our night of GIRLS GIRLS GIRLS talks in Feb, we’re back with Casey and Nudrat in April… The first of this year’s talks in Leeds looks at photographic representations of girls. We have speakers Casey Orr and Nudrat Afza giving us an insight into the creation of their projects surrounding girls and women. +++ Weds 18th April, 2018. Doors at 6pm, kicks off at 7pm.  The Brunswick, Leeds.  Free Entry. +++ Nudrat Afza Image […]
